Pyrus

Tree native to the USA with an upright and oval crown. Deciduous leaves bright green, turning yellow to red in autumn, early to bud and late to fall, oval-shaped about 10 cm long and rather tough. It blooms in April with simple white flowers. Fruits are pear-like, not very abundant. Prefers neutral to calcareous and fresh soils, but also grows in poor soils. Resistant to diseases and pollution, widely used in street plantings.
